Output e58359f4957735a1966c39387bbe9b336652b59c7067b9487fb0220b0ec5c73f:5

value
149850300
script pubkey
OP_0 OP_PUSHBYTES_20 af8d09bbfb51852c8ed9704867d195322052f6c5
address
bc1q47xsnwlm2xzjerkewpyx05v4xgs99ak9gnahuu
transaction
e58359f4957735a1966c39387bbe9b336652b59c7067b9487fb0220b0ec5c73f
spent
true